This atlas, intended for all bird watchers and enthusiasts, contains over 1,400 photographs, accompanying illustrations, and maps. For each species, a large photograph highlights its typical features, a smaller photo in a cutout shows the bird in flight, and an accompanying illustration depicts the female or a young individual. All of this, along with a clear description, allows for easy and reliable identification. Additionally, each species is accompanied by a map of its summer and winter distribution. Searching in the book is very convenient and quick thanks to the color-coded system. Finally, the book includes several plates depicting the eggs of the most well-known bird species. Detlef Singer is the author and translator of professional books on nature and ornithology. In addition to his publishing activities, he undertakes study trips across Europe and is involved in photographing and filming nature. He has collaborated on a series of documentaries with the ZDF station, for example. He now lives with his family in Sweden.
